Abdullah v. 28th Precinct et al
Plaintiff: Abdul H. Abdullah
Defendant: 28th Precinct, P.O. Gracia M. Carlos, Sergeant Seyed N. Huda, P.O. Carlos M. Gracia and City of New York
Case Number: 1:2024cv00139
Filed: January 2, 2024
Court: US District Court for the Southern District of New York
Presiding Judge: J Paul Oetken
Nature of Suit: Prisoner: Prison Condition
Cause of Action: 42 U.S.C. § 1983 Civil Rights Act
Jury Demanded By: None

February 20, 2024 Opinion or Order Filing 7 ORDER OF SERVICE: The Court dismisses Plaintiff's claims against 28th Precinct because it does have the capacity to be sued. The Clerk of Court is directed to add the City of New York as a Defendant under Fed. R. Civ. P. 21. The Clerk of Court is further instructed to issue summonses for the City of New York, Sergeant Seyed N. Huda, and Officer Carlos M. Gracia, complete the USM-285 forms with the addresses for these defendants, and deliver all documents necessary to effect service to the U.S. Marshals Service. The Clerk of Court also is directed to mail Plaintiff an information package. Plaintiff may receive court documents by email by completing the attached form, Consent to Electronic Service. The Court certifies under 28 U.S.C. 1915(a)(3) that any appeal from this order would not be taken in good faith, and therefore IFP status is denied for the purpose of an appeal. Cf. Coppedge v. United States, 369 U.S. 438, 444-45 (1962) (holding that an appellant demonstrates good faith when he seeks review of a nonfrivolous issue). SO ORDERED., City of New York added. 28th Precinct terminated. (Signed by Judge J. Paul Oetken on 2/20/24) (yv) Transmission to Pro Se Assistants for processing.

January 29, 2024 Opinion or Order Filing 4 ORDER TO AMEND: The Court dismisses Plaintiff's claims against the NYPD's 28th Precinct. See N.Y. City Charter ch. 17, 396. Plaintiff is granted leave to file an amended complaint that complies with the standards set forth above. Plaintiff must submit the amended complaint to this Court's Pro Se Intake Unit within sixty days of the date of this order, caption the document as an "Amended Complaint," and label the document with docket number 24-CV-0139 (LTS). An Amended Complaint form is attached to this order. No summons will issue at this time. If Plaintiff fails to comply within the time allowed, and he cannot show good cause to excuse such failure, the complaint will be dismissed for failure to state a claim upon which relief may be granted, and the Court will decline, under 28 U.S.C. 1367(c)(3), to exercise supplemental jurisdiction of any state law claims Plaintiff may be asserting. Plaintiff may receive court documents by email by completing the attached form, Consent to Electronic Service. The Court certifies under 28 U.S.C. 1915(a)(3) that any appeal from this order would not be taken in good faith, and therefore IFP status is denied for the purpose of an appeal. Cf. Coppedge v. United States, 369 U.S. 438, 444-45 (1962) (holding that an appellant demonstrates good faith when he seeks review of a nonfrivolous issue). SO ORDERED. (Signed by Judge Laura Taylor Swain on 1/29/2024) (va)
